28 Individuals Will Represent American Schools In Rio

OLYMPIC COVERAGE

Twenty-three current or former student-athletes from American Athletic Conference schools will be competing in the Rio 2016 Olympics. The Olympic Games kick off today, August 5, and will run until August 21.

The 23 athletes will be representing 12 different countries with eight athletes competing for the United States. Along with the 23 athletes, five coaches will be heading to the Olympic Games. In total, nine American Athletic Conference schools will be represented by an athlete or coach in the Olympics.

UConn and SMU will both have seven current or former athletes competing in the Games as well as each school sending a coach to Rio.
